Output d065d069e62ac8d35767eb8ecab9e7ad2bdf5d92eb1282cda2c0365c6103096f:1

value
164005084036
script pubkey
OP_0 OP_PUSHBYTES_20 74b0a4e3b8ed14bd70a7a83b8f6fd2b852eb1beb
address
tb1qwjc2fcaca52t6u984qac7m7jhpfwkxlt0sxule
transaction
d065d069e62ac8d35767eb8ecab9e7ad2bdf5d92eb1282cda2c0365c6103096f
confirmations
80622
spent
true